Victorian Roses Ladies Riding Society’s Wild West Casino Night a fundraiser for horse rescues

Saturday night, there were no “yeehaw” screams and horseshoes flying on the dusty ground at the Lakeside Rodeo, but one could hear the clink of glasses, the dices at play as chips hit the gambling tables along with the rustling of the long fluffy brocade dresses on the waxed floors. This was the fifth edition of the Wild West Casino Nights organized by the Victorian Roses Ladies Riding Society, a charitable organization that participates in events throughout the year. This fundraiser was to raise money for other local horse rescue groups.

Dressed up to reconstitute the golden times of the 1800’s era, the guests looked mighty fine in their gentlemen’s dandy outfits, recalling the American Civil War times filled with carpetbaggers and saloon girls, cowboys and the Spanish rancher outfits, also known as vaquero suits. The ladies of the Victorian Roses took the prize at being the most historical accurate, wearing one of a kind, silky, flamboyant dresses they make themselves to teach people about the historical times of the 1880’s.

Wild West Casino nights is only one of the events organized throughout the years to raise funds for horse rescue efforts. The lovely ladies were chosen to participate in the Rose Parade for the fourth time this year, riding old carriages, horses and side saddling at the Del Mar race, giving performances for educational purposes at the rodeo shows and organizing fashion shows in the winter to teach people about the old costume styles.

“My saddle is 120 years old,” said Dyan Paquette, a co-founder of this eight-year-old organization. She also sews her own dresses. The access into the Victorian Roses society is invite only and counts about 20 members so far throughout San Diego County. These ladies know how to dance the cotillion too.

Paquette came up with the idea of organizing the casino nights after going to a casino themed birthday party many years ago and right now this event is becoming very successful at raising awareness and fund for horse rescue organizations. Susan Lord, volunteer for the Horses of Tir Na Nog, one of the local organizations benefiting from this event, points out that more people should be aware of the existence of these shelters for horses.

“We are their only option, because we take in horses that are not adoptable. Nobody wants them. We offer them a forever home,” she said.

Another horse sanctuary for non-ridable horses, Star Bright Ranch, led by Becca and Chad Campbell of Ramona, was among the beneficiaries of this fundraising event.

“We host horses that either through injuries or old age they not longer become ridable for their owners, but still have quality of life and we offer them a pasture environment where they can just retire with dignity without being euthanized,” said Becca Campbell.

Niki Branch, the President of the Falcon Ridge from Valley Center, takes care of horses coming from the San Diego Animal Control cases and from individual owners who give up their horses. Her organization takes in the animals, rehabilitate them and then adopt them out with a 100 percent annual success rate. Branch has been doing this for the past 15 years. She dreamed of saving horses since she was a teenager when she used to ride them, but one day, after she watched a documentary about slaughter horses on “Animal Planet,” she decided to dedicate her life to save horses.

The whole evening was a huge success and a welcoming event for the locals of Lakeside, well-known country ground for horse people who love to spend a night recreating the golden days of the past atmosphere, while helping noble causes.
